The grand hall. Guests, nobles, servants, dancers, musicians, priests, guards, the Emperor, the Empress and the Princess.

It was the Princess's birthday; held luxuriously every year. As usual, the royal family sat down on royal thrones and chairs, enjoying the scene. The Emperor had a cold frown on his face, the Empress sat with much elegance and lips curled up into a gentle smile and the Princess had a blank expression on her face while she listened to the music.

A group of maids came to the Princess and bowed. The little Princess lifted her head to them. "Princess, it's time for you to get ready for your special dance performance," a maid said. The Princess looked at her mother, the Empress, and imagined her nodding.

The Princess got up and let the maids lead her to a room outside the grand hall.
The Empress watched anxiously at the departure of the Princess from the grand hall.

* * *

The Emperor slapped his bodyguard who fell to the ground with a crash.
"How many times did I tell you to keep an eye on the Princess?!" the Emperor roared.

"But, Your Majesty." The bodyguard bowed. "She was taken away by a group of maids to get ready forㅡ"

"I do not care about maids! They are being taken care of right now. My question is, how could you let them take her away without any objection?!" the Emperor roared again.

They were in the Emperor's room. The Emperor, the Empress, the Princess's bodyguardㅡ the Head Bodyguard and his family.

"Your Majesty! Please spare him!" the Head Bodyguard's wife pleaded. "Join your hands, pray before His Majesty!" she yelled at her twelve-year-old. The boy flinched and joined his hands.

"Please spare us, Your Majesty..." he said, frightened.

"What will you do now?" the Emperor grabbed a fistful of the Head Bodyguard's clothes and lifted him off the ground.

"Your Majesty, Iㅡ" the man started but was cut off again as the Emperor threw him on the ground. He landed with a loud noise, wincing at the pain on his side.

"Will you pay for our loss?! Do you even know how serious this is?!" the Emperor growled, placing his foot on the man's head.

"Your Majesty!" the Empress said. "Calm down, Your Majesty!"

"Do not interfere, Empress! Are you not worried about the Princess now?! She was your dear daughter, wasn't she?! What happened to all your love towards her?!" the Emperor screamed at the Empress with bloodshot eyes.

"But, Your Majesty, we should stay calmㅡ"

"Calm, my foot!" the Emperor growled and pressed his foot harder so that the man's skull nearly crushed beneath the pressure.

"You will pay for this, you bastard!" the Emperor screamed and unsheathed his sword.

"No! No, Your Majesty!" the man's wife broke down into tears as she continued to beg the Emperor to leave her husband.

The sound of the piercing of flesh came flowing into everyone's ear, followed by the sound of painful wailing. The Emperor slashed the man's body into pieces.

"Your Majesty!" the wife howled, pulling her son closer to her, afraid he might get hurt. The child watched in dazed horror. The man lay, dead and motionless, his blood surrounding him, forming a pool.

His wife howled and cried out her pain. His son watched the body of his father with empty eyes. The Empress was stunned at the scene. The Emperor pierced his sword through the man's heart, making sure he no longer stays alive. The man's blood splattered on his family's clothes.

"This is what he gets..." the Emperor said slowly, his breath ragged and his eyes the colour of the Crimson Moon.

Suddenly, he grabbed the man's wife's arm wildly and lifted her aggressively. "You..." he growled, studying the woman from head to toe. The woman shrunk under his furious gaze.

"You will pay for it too."

He quickly ordered his men to lock the howling woman up as he dragged her away to whatever place he wanted to keep her.

The child watched as the Emperor snatched his mother away. His eyes kept straying from his father's lifeless body and the door through which they left.

Why didn't he stop the Emperor? Was it because he was little, powerless and afraid of him? If he stopped the angry man, perhaps he could have saved his father. What if the cruel Emperor killed his mother too?

The Empress looked at him, her eyes moist with silent tears. She walked over to him and sat down to meet his height.

"Listen. Can you do me a favour?" she asked, placing a hand on his cheekㅡ an action which reminded him of his mother.

He cocked his head to the side.
"Can you forget everything you saw today and grow up to be powerful?" the Empress asked, sniffing away her tears. He did not answer.

"No, don't forget anything. Remember this moment and grow up strong. You cannot crumble, okay? Grow up strong," the Empress said, with a flame of what he assumed was called determination in her eyes. "Take your revenge." the Empress said, grabbing his shoulders and giving them a light squeeze.

Take your revenge...
Revenge?

The child burst into tears. The Empress pulled him into an embrace and patted his head. "My mother... what will happen to her?" he cried. "Father is dead..." he cried.

"Cry as much as you can right now. Let all your pain out in your cries. But save your rage for the time of revenge..." she said.

The child set his mind while he cried on the Empress's shoulder.

I will seek revenge on the Princess and the Emperor, he repeated several times in his head.
